The face of new business, Grace Whitehouse

Heading up Gateway Property Management’s New Business team is Grace Whitehouse. She joined in April 2012 and, over the past five years, has seen the company’s property portfolio expand rapidly. Grace explains why she enjoys working in the industry and sets out tomorrow’s ambitions.

Try a career in property is Grace’s advice to young talent. “Until you’re working within the industry, you’re not fully aware of everything it involves. There are so many facets and there is always something new to learn.” Grace joined Gateway in April 2012, bringing a property insurance background to the company. Her first role was to support the Board as a PA and develop the offering from Associated Insurance Services, part of the Gateway Group. Five months on and Grace had made her first internal move into Gateway’s Property Management arm. “The property management business has gone from strength to strength and I’ve enjoyed lots of opportunities to advance professionally, both in sales enquiry and new business positions. It’s all been extremely positive.”

In March 2016, Grace embarked on her latest Gateway journey as the New Business Manager. “The role is varied and no two days are the same,” she explains. “A key responsibility is looking after, and building relationships with, existing and new property developers. “This includes visiting residential developments, from their infancy during construction to the point where the development is ready to be handed over to Gateway Property Management to manage.” Grace enjoys the collaborative nature of her work. “What we do involves the whole company, from senior management to the team on the ground. I’m fortunate to work with a wide range of people at Gateway.” It’s the level of teamwork that has always impressed Grace. “People here are really supportive. This is something I identified with from day one.”

Along with general marketing, another important part of her role is getting a foot in the door to win new business. “Every developer needs an exemplary property management agent,” says Grace. “Recently, we have submitted a number of successful tenders and added another major housebuilder to our client base. We’re frequently gaining new business from recommendations. This demonstrates that Gateway as a whole works hard to ensure we deliver the level of service we pride ourselves on.”

What’s behind the successes to date? Grace points to Gateway’s proactive, customer-service focus. “Considering the tens of thousands of units we manage throughout the UK, our rating is outstanding in the sector.” Transparency and the Gateway’s Group offering also resonate with clients. “We can offer a fully encompassing service in so many areas of property, from advising on lease structures to buying ground rents and managing properties. We’re already nationwide, which has been an enormous achievement that’s happened in a relatively short space of time.” The goal is to keep on growing, sustaining and attracting property developers, Resident Management Companies (RMCs) and independent landlords nationally. “We look forward to seeing the Gateway name on more and more property boards across the country.”
